Resumo

In the influence blocking maximization problem, we aim to minimize the spread of disinformation in a network. More specifically, given a set of nodes that initiate the spread of disinformation and an integer k, we must find k nodes in the network to serve as the starting point for competing (say, correct) information so that the misinformation spread is minimized. In this paper, we propose a version of the problem under a dissemination model derived from the Competitive Linear Threshold model. We present an integer linear programming formulation for the problem that, as far as we know, inaugurates the use of mathematical programming in dissemination problems with two competing cascades. We performed experiments to verify the quality of our formulation, evaluating the integrality gap and the scalability. Such results can serve as a baseline for future solutions using integer linear programming.
